Motorola has once again raised the bar in the world of smartphones with the release of their latest flagship device, the Motorola Razr60 Ultra. This high-end smartphone is set to hit the market in April 2025, and it is already causing a buzz among tech enthusiasts and consumers alike.

One of the most striking features of the Motorola Razr60 Ultra is its innovative design. The smartphone boasts a sleek and sophisticated look, thanks to its premium materials and attention to detail. The body of the device is crafted from a combination of aluminium alloy and leather, giving it a luxurious feel and a durable build. The front and back of the phone are protected by Corning Gorilla Glass Victus, ensuring that it can withstand everyday wear and tear.

The Motorola Razr60 Ultra features a large screen that measures 6.90 inches and utilizes pOLED technology. With a resolution of 1080x2640 (FHD+), a refresh rate of 165 Hz, a peak brightness of 3000 cd/m², and a contrast ratio of 5000000:1, this display delivers vibrant colors, sharp details, and smooth animations. The usable surface of the screen covers an impressive 84.8% of the front panel, providing users with an immersive viewing experience.

In addition to its main display, the Motorola Razr60 Ultra also comes equipped with a secondary screen on the outside of the device. This LTPO AMOLED screen measures 4 inches and offers a peak brightness of 2400 nits, a refresh rate of 165 Hz, and a resolution of 1272 x 1080 pixels with a pixel density of 417ppi. The secondary screen is protected by Gorilla Glass Victus and supports HDR10+. When the phone is folded, the dimensions measure 88.1x74x15.3 mm, making it compact and easy to carry around.

When it comes to performance, the Motorola Razr60 Ultra does not disappoint. The smartphone is powered by the Qualcomm Snapdragon 8 Elite processor, built on 3nm technology. This cutting-edge chipset ensures smooth multitasking, seamless gaming, and lightning-fast responsiveness. Users can choose between 12GB or 16GB of RAM and opt for storage options ranging from 256GB to a massive 1TB. With an AnTuTu benchmark score of 1865776, the Motorola Razr60 Ultra is sure to deliver top-notch performance in any situation.

Security is also a top priority for Motorola, which is why they have included a side-mounted fingerprint sensor on the Razr60 Ultra. This convenient and secure biometric authentication method allows users to unlock their device with just a touch of their finger.

When it comes to photography, the Motorola Razr60 Ultra shines with its dual camera setup. The main camera features a Samsung GNJ sensor with 50.0 megapixels, an f/1.8 aperture, a pixel size of 0.700, and Samsung's ISOCELL technology. The wide-angle lens is equipped with a Sony IMX816 sensor with 50.0 megapixels, an f/2.0 aperture, and Sony's ISOCELL technology. For selfies, the device sports a Samsung S5KJNS sensor with 50.0 megapixels, though further details are unknown. Optical stabilization (OIS) and 4K video recording capabilities ensure that users can capture stunning photos and videos with ease.

Connectivity options on the Motorola Razr60 Ultra include Bluetooth 5.3, dual SIM support, NFC, WiFi 6 (802.11ax), and eSIM compatibility. These features ensure that users can stay connected and share data seamlessly across various devices.

Powering the Motorola Razr60 Ultra is a robust 4500mAh battery that supports fast charging up to 45.0W. Additionally, the device includes wireless charging capabilities, allowing users to recharge their phone without the hassle of cables. The Razr60 Ultra also supports reverse charging, making it a convenient power source for other devices.

  • One of my best Phones - Really comfortable to use with one hand, easy to carry in your pocket, Incredible performance

    My first time using a foldable phone, and I can say it’s more than I expected.
    First of all, it’s really comfortable to use. With the large cover screen, you can run almost every single app, and this feature really helps you stay on top of urgent things (like messages, calls, or important notifications) without getting dragged into other time-consuming apps.

    Battery:
    It performs much better than I thought. It easily lasts me all day, especially considering that you mainly use the cover screen, which is more energy-efficient. In fact, the battery seems to last even longer than my previous regular phone. Another great feature is the fast charging — the real fast charging. I’m not talking about the old 20W “fast” charge; with this model, you get up to 68W, going from 10% to 80% in just over half an hour. It’s incredibly convenient when you need a quick charge before leaving home and realize you’ve forgotten to plug it in earlier.

    Cameras:
    They’re amazing! Finally, Motorola included an ultra-wide lens, which makes perfect sense since you’ll often take group selfies with the main cameras and want to capture as much of the background as possible. The video stabilization really impressed me — even when walking on uneven terrain, the video stays smooth. The front camera is good enough for video calls, but I usually use the main cameras instead; it’s much better to hold the phone with one hand or fold it halfway and place it on a table for a hands-free call.

    Durability:
    This is probably its weakest point. You should take good care of the large screen, as it’s a foldable display. Although the overall design feels quite robust (titatium), I still have some doubts about its long-term durability. I'm not sure How it will endurance a fall.

    I also wish the cover screen offered more options for customization — more styles and add-ins would make it even better.

    In my opinion this is the best phones on this format flip format.

What is a Ki score?
Ki is an automatic score based on the specifications and prices of devices. It is calculated using over 200 variables to rank smartphones, tablets and other devices from best to worst.
How do we calculate the Ki?

In this case, to determine the score we evaluate 5 general aspects:

  • Design and screen
  • Hardware and performance
  • Camera
  • Connectivity
  • Battery

Once these 5 factors have been rated, we introduce the price variable. This means that any two devices with the same ratings get a different Ki score for quality vs price.

Even a device objectively worse than another may have a higher Ki score if it has a better price.

Does the Ki score change?

The Ki varies as time goes by. As new devices with better specifications enter the market the Ki score of older devices will go down, always being compensated of their decrease in price.
